Ive been using the 138 for about 6 weeks now and I love it. It is quite stiff compared to alot of boards but still gives a nice smooth ride. As you would expect from LF who make so many wakeboards, the shape is nicely refined. No filthy big ridge between the double concave like other brands. It has a subtle double concave in the tips, flushes into a single concave in the middle. The rail profile changes around the board from a sharp, hard rail ay the tips, rounder thicker in between the feet. I changed the big fins for long low ones.
I have loaned it to a few guys and I have only had positive comments about it, I actually had trouble getting it back off one of them...
My mate is a big bloke so he got the 144. He seems pleased with his, but after riding mine with bindings, he is looking at replacing his straps with boots.
